What does Phoenix mean?
Phoenix means dark red and comes from Greek origin.
ssociated with a legendary bird of rebirth from ancient tales, Phoenix carries a powerful resonance, suggesting renewal and the fiery spirit of transformation. Its sound flows in two dynamic syllables, starting with a bold ‘F’ and ending with a sharp ‘S’, making it a distinctive choice. The mythological backdrop evokes images of rising from ashes, a potent emblem of resilience and strength.
